The Role Includes:

  • Fabrication of stainless steel handrail and balustrade components

  • TIG welding and finishing of stainless steel products

  • Measuring, marking out, cutting, and preparation

  • Polishing and quality checking finished components

  • Reading and working from technical drawings

  • Maintaining a safe, clean, and organised workspace

  • Working as part of a small, reliable production team

This role is both workshop & installation based depending on project requirements.
